WBC super middleweight champion Carl Froch is not even thinking about a possible fight with countryman Nathan Cleverly - until the Welsh boxer is able to become a world class fighter. He feels Cleverly is still a "domestic level" boxer. Cleverly faces Juergen Braehmer for the WBO light heavyweight title on May 21 at London’s O2 Arena. Cleverly stated recently that he would like a showdown with Froch in the near future. If Cleverly is able to beat Braehmer, Froch would regard him as "world level" boxer and only then would he consider a possible fight.
